The Lead Custodian is responsible for assisting with the supervision, delegation, and oversight of custodial staff to ensure a clean, safe, and welcoming environment throughout Laguna Development Corporation (LDC) casinos and related facilities. This role supports daily custodial operations by coordinating work assignments, training employees on proper cleaning techniques, maintaining cleaning equipment, and enforcing departmental procedures and safety standards. Duties include performing and overseeing a wide range of cleaning tasks such as vacuuming, mopping, sweeping, scrubbing, trash removal, restroom sanitation, cleaning gaming tables and slot machines, and maintaining windows, carpets, walls, doors, and furnishings. The Lead Custodian also participates in meetings and training programs, including the annual Supervisory Development Leadership Series (SDLS), while maintaining a strong commitment to teamwork, operational efficiency, and exceptional service standards.

Successful candidates are expected to model LDC’s core values by maintaining professionalism, reliability, and positive working relationships with guests, coworkers, vendors, and the public. The position requires the ability to work under pressure, maintain regular attendance, and work flexible schedules, including weekends, holidays, and unusual hours. Preferred qualifications include a high school diploma or GED, one to two years of custodial experience with demonstrated leadership ability, and knowledge of cleaning chemicals, safety procedures, and custodial equipment such as vacuums, extractors, and chariot vacuums. The role involves significant physical demands, including standing, walking, bending, lifting, pushing, and carrying materials throughout the workday, as well as strong problem-solving, organizational, reading, and decision-making skills. Work is performed indoors with exposure to loud noise and fumes, and candidates must be able to obtain and maintain a gaming license through the Pueblo of Laguna Gaming Control Board and pass a pre-employment alcohol and drug screening.
